    Boston-Providence already exists. DTG has stated that they already have sounds for the Acela when they went out to get audio recordings of the ACS64. DC-Philadelphia and NY-Boston are way too long to be possible to do. Would be much better off doing NY-Philadelphia or DC-Baltimore. Trust me when I say you do not want the Acela on a route like New York-New Haven or even farther to New London. You won’t even break 100mph
